Transaction 791bfae5c49d5092bcb87cfda3a478923681aadaefd6de031c2b758e9e352494

2 Input
2 Outputs
  • 791bfae5c49d5092bcb87cfda3a478923681aadaefd6de031c2b758e9e352494:0
  • value  5672000
    address  3EEZcdNun6UVZjP5kCD8NmTuS1FPaoSfFJ
  • 791bfae5c49d5092bcb87cfda3a478923681aadaefd6de031c2b758e9e352494:1
  • value  1879438
    address  1759xgEXurVRqNo5rDPbezHBqzoisujvnp